虚拟空间的控制方法、控制系统和计算机可读存储介质技术方案

技术编号:19695956 阅读:25 留言:0更新日期:2018-12-08 12:14
本发明专利技术提出了一种虚拟空间的控制方法和虚拟空间的控制系统。其中,虚拟空间的控制方法包括:获取用户预设方向的视频数据,视频数据中每帧图像具有时间标识;获取预存的虚拟空间中各个用户的位置信息;根据位置信息,获取虚拟空间中任一用户指定方向上所有其他用户同一时间标识的指定图像;将指定图像预处理后进行合成,获得合成图像,将指定图像的时间标识作为合成图像的时间标识;按照时间标识的时间顺序,将合成图像发送至任一用户的使用端,以使任一用户的使用端在指定方向的显示装置显示合成图像。本发明专利技术可以使在不同的地点使用该虚拟空间的用户具有所有用户如同在同一真实空间的感受,提高了用户体验度。

【技术实现步骤摘要】
虚拟空间的控制方法、控制系统和计算机可读存储介质
本专利技术涉及远程虚拟空间控制
,具体而言,涉及一种虚拟空间的控制方法、虚拟空间的控制系统和计算机可读存储介质。
技术介绍
当前社会出现了很多在线教育在线讲座的教学方式,这种远程教学的效果不如真实的上课环境,究其原因,主要是这种在线教学的方式下,教师或学生都没有一种身在教室的实际体会。又或是需要进行开会的会议人员,因不是同一地点,无法在同一真实会议室进行会议,就需要使用远程虚拟会议室,然而目前远程虚拟会议室也无法使参会人员具有如同在同一真实会议室开会的感受,会议效果大打折扣。
技术实现思路
本专利技术旨在至少解决现有技术或相关技术中存在的技术问题之一。为此,本专利技术第一个方面在于提出一种虚拟空间的控制方法。本专利技术的第二个方面在于提出一种虚拟空间的控制系统。本专利技术的第三个方面在于提出一种计算机可读存储介质。有鉴于此,根据本专利技术的一个方面,提出了一种虚拟空间的控制方法,包括:获取用户预设方向的视频数据,视频数据中每帧图像具有时间标识;获取预存的虚拟空间中各个用户的位置信息;根据位置信息,获取虚拟空间中任一用户指定方向上所有其他用户同一时间标识的指定图像;将指定图像预处理后进行合成,获得合成图像,将指定图像的时间标识作为合成图像的时间标识;按照时间标识的时间顺序,将合成图像发送至任一用户的使用端,以使任一用户的使用端在指定方向的显示装置显示合成图像。本专利技术提供的虚拟空间的控制方法,首先获取用户使用端预设方向的视频数据,预设方向是预先设定的方向,比如正前方,正后方、左方、右方等,在根据各个用户预先选择的虚拟空间的位置信息,获取某个用户指定方向上所有用户同一时间标识的指定图像,比如,获取虚拟空间上用户A左边所有用户时间在B时刻的指定图像,指定图像为朝向用户A的图像,在将获取的所有用户图像进行合成,获取合成图像之后,将合衬图像按照时间标识顺序发送至该用户使用端指定方向上的显示装置进行显示,即将合成的视频数据发送至该用户,使得该用户感受所有其他用户如同在同一真实空间,如同所有用户身处同一真实空间,所有用户就在身边,提高了虚拟空间的用户体验感。根据本专利技术的上述虚拟空间的控制方法,还可以具有以下技术特征:在上述技术方案中,优选地,位置信息包括:用户与虚拟空间中位置的绑定信息和虚拟空间中各个用户的距离信息;在获取用户预设方向的视频数据之前,还包括:获取用户对虚拟空间的座位选择指令;根据座位选择指令为用户分配对应的座位,并将用户与对应的座位进行绑定,获得并保存绑定信息。在该技术方案中,在用户使用虚拟空间时,首先进行对虚拟空间的座位进行选择,使得用户与虚拟座位具有一一对应的对应关系,将该对应关系进行绑定,就可以针对某一用户进行视频数据合成时,查询到相对应的绑定座位,以及虚拟教室中座位的位置距离以及位置角度关系,进而根据虚拟座位进行合成相对虚拟视频,实现用户使用虚拟空间的真实感。在上述任一技术方案中,优选地,将指定图像预处理后进行合成,获得合成图像,具体包括:保留指定图像中其他用户及预设装置的图像,获得第一预处理图像,指定图像为朝向任一用户的图像;根据位置信息获取在虚拟空间中任一用户与其他用户的距离,按照预设缩小比例将第一预处理图像进行缩小处理,距离与缩小比例为正相关;将第二预处理图像与虚拟空间在指定方向的第一预设图像合成,获得合成图像。在该技术方案中,在将指定图像进行合成时,首先保留指定图像中其他用户以及预设装置的图像,获取第一预处理图像,比如,虚拟空间是虚拟教室,就保留学生用户和书桌座椅的图像,保留教室用户以及课桌的图像;如果虚拟空间是虚拟会议室,就保留会议参与者用户与会议桌的图像,即预设装置与虚拟空间的类型有关,再获取该任一用户与其他用户的虚拟教室的位置关系,包括位置距离以及位置角度,根据位置角度明确其他用户的图像为朝向该任一用户的方向,根据位置距离对第一预处理图像进行缩放,获得第二预处理图像,距离该任一用户较近的其他用户缩小比例小,距离该任一用户距离较远的其他用户缩小比例大,使得缩放后的图像与真实视觉效果相同,在进行缩小之后,再将该指定方向上预设的虚拟空间的墙壁画面合成至第二预处理图像中,如此,就获得该任一用户指定方向上合成图像,按照时间标识顺序拼接,即为指定方向的合成视频,合成的视频符合视觉常理,使得任一用户能感受到其他用户如同真实的坐在自己旁边。在上述任一技术方案中,优选地,虚拟空间包括:远程教学的虚拟教室、虚拟会议室、虚拟培训室;当虚拟空间为虚拟教室时,用户包括:学生端的用户和教师端的用户。在该技术方案中,虚拟空间的类型可以为虚拟教室、虚拟会议室。虚拟培训室,当然,本专利技术的虚拟空间不限于上述类型。本专利技术适用于多类型的虚拟空间,使得多方面的虚拟空间使用者均可以具有真实的空间感受。当虚拟空间为远程教学的虚拟教室时,用户包括:学生端的用户和教师端的用户。在上述任一技术方案中,优选地,获取用户预设方向的视频数据,具体包括:通过学生端第一预设方向的第一图像采集装置获取视频数据;和/或控制学生端的第二图像采集终端按照预设轨迹运行,当第二图像采集装置运行至第二预设方向时,采集视频数据;和/或通过教师端第三预设方向的第三图像采集装置获取视频数据。在该技术方案中,获取用户预设方向的视频数据,可以通过学生端第一预设方向的第一图像采集装置进行获取,第一预设方向可以学生端用户前、后、左、右方向,也可以根据需要其他方向上设置图像采集装置;获取视频数据还可以通过控制学生端第二图像采集装置按照预设轨迹运行,在第二预设方向进行采集数据,预设轨迹可以为环绕学生端用户的运动轨迹,如此可以实现使用较少的图像采集装置获取各个方向的视频数据;还可以通过教师端用户第三预设方向的第三图像采集装置获取视频数据。通过教师端和学生端多种图像采集方式获取所需视频数据,为虚拟视频数据合成提供基础。根据本专利技术的第二个方面,提出了一种虚拟空间的控制系统,包括:存储器,用于存储计算机程序;处理器,用于执行计算机程序以:获取用户预设方向的视频数据,视频数据中每帧图像具有时间标识;获取预存的虚拟空间中各个用户的位置信息;根据位置信息,获取虚拟空间中任一用户指定方向上所有其他用户同一时间标识的指定图像;将指定图像预处理后进行合成,获得合成图像,将指定图像的时间标识作为合成图像的时间标识;按照时间标识的时间顺序,将合成图像发送至任一用户的使用端,以使任一用户的使用端在指定方向的显示装置显示合成图像。本专利技术提供的虚拟空间的控制系统,存储器存储计算机程序;处理器执行计算机程序时,首先获取用户使用端预设方向的视频数据,预设方向是预先设定的方向,比如正前方,正后方、左方、右方等,在根据各个用户预先选择的虚拟空间的位置信息,获取某个用户指定方向上所有用户同一时间标识的指定图像,比如,获取虚拟空间上用户A左边所有用户时间在B时刻的指定图像,指定图像为朝向用户A的图像,在将获取的所有用户图像进行合成,获取合成图像之后,将合衬图像按照时间标识顺序发送至该用户使用端指定方向上的显示装置进行显示,即将合成的视频数据发送至该用户,使得该用户感受所有其他用户如同在同一真实空间,如同所有用户身处同一真实空间,所有用户就在身边,提高了虚拟空间的用户体验感本文档来自技高网...

【技术保护点】
1.一种虚拟空间的控制方法,其特征在于,包括:获取用户预设方向的视频数据,所述视频数据中每帧图像具有时间标识;获取预存的所述虚拟空间中各个用户的位置信息;根据所述位置信息,获取所述虚拟空间中任一用户指定方向上所有其他用户同一所述时间标识的指定图像;将所述指定图像预处理后进行合成,获得合成图像,将所述指定图像的时间标识作为所述合成图像的时间标识;按照所述时间标识的时间顺序,将所述合成图像发送至所述任一用户的使用端,以使所述任一用户的使用端在所述指定方向的显示装置显示所述合成图像。

【技术特征摘要】
1.一种虚拟空间的控制方法,其特征在于,包括:获取用户预设方向的视频数据,所述视频数据中每帧图像具有时间标识;获取预存的所述虚拟空间中各个用户的位置信息;根据所述位置信息,获取所述虚拟空间中任一用户指定方向上所有其他用户同一所述时间标识的指定图像;将所述指定图像预处理后进行合成,获得合成图像,将所述指定图像的时间标识作为所述合成图像的时间标识;按照所述时间标识的时间顺序,将所述合成图像发送至所述任一用户的使用端,以使所述任一用户的使用端在所述指定方向的显示装置显示所述合成图像。2.根据权利要求1所述的虚拟空间的控制方法,其特征在于,所述位置信息包括:所述用户与所述虚拟空间中位置的绑定信息和所述虚拟空间中各个用户的距离信息;在所述获取用户预设方向的视频数据之前,还包括:获取所述用户对所述虚拟空间的座位选择指令;根据座位选择指令为所述用户分配对应的座位,并将所述用户与所述对应的座位进行绑定,获得并保存所述绑定信息。3.根据权利要求1所述的虚拟空间的控制方法,其特征在于,所述将所述指定图像预处理后进行合成,获得合成图像,具体包括:保留所述指定图像中所述其他用户及预设装置的图像,获得第一预处理图像,所述指定图像为朝向所述任一用户的图像;根据所述位置信息获取在所述虚拟空间中所述任一用户与所述其他用户的距离,按照预设缩小比例将所述第一预处理图像进行缩小处理,所述距离与所述缩小比例为正相关;将所述第二预处理图像与所述虚拟空间在所述指定方向的第一预设图像合成,获得所述合成图像。4.根据权利要求1至3中任一项所述的虚拟空间的控制方法,其特征在于,所述虚拟空间包括:远程教学的虚拟教室、虚拟会议室、虚拟培训室;当所述虚拟空间为所述虚拟教室时,所述用户包括:学生端的用户和教师端的用户。5.根据权利要求4所述的虚拟空间的控制方法,其特征在于,所述获取用户预设方向的视频数据,具体包括:通过所述学生端第一预设方向的第一图像采集装置获取所述视频数据;和/或控制所述学生端的第二图像采集终端按照预设轨迹运行,当所述第二图像采集装置运行至第二预设方向时,采集所述视频数据;和/或通过所述教师端第三预设方向的第三图像采集装置获取所述视频数据。6.一种虚拟空间的控制系统,其特征在于,包括:存储器,用于存储计算机程序;处理器,用于执行所...

【专利技术属性】
技术研发人员:陈德刚
申请(专利权)人:深圳中兴网信科技有限公司
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1